History
Surgical Associates of South Carolina, P.A. was
formed in 1996 when two large practices, South Carolina Surgical
Associates and Columbia Surgical Associates, merged. South Carolina
Surgical Associates had been formed in 1963 and Columbia Surgical
Associates was formed in 1959 by Dr. Daniel W. Davis.
South Carolina Surgical brought in to the group Dr. Dail W. Longaker,
Dr. David E. Tribble, Dr. Robert H. Bunch (whose father George
co-founded the practice), Dr. J Benjamin Tribble, and Dr. Dalton S.
Prickett. Columbia Surgical Associates brought eight physicians into
the group including Dr. Daniel W. Davis, Dr. C. Alden Sweatman. Jr.,
Dr. Neal R. Reynolds, Dr. Sidney E. Morrison, III, Dr. Chad A.
Rubin, and three other doctors who have since formed their own
practice in Lexington County. Dr. Jose Mena joined Surgical
Associates of South Carolina in July of 1997. Dr. Davis retired from
the practice in August of 1996.
